お知らせ • Mar 03+ 1 more updateKPS Capital Partners, LP completed the acquisition of 51% stake in Ketjen Corporation from Albemarle Corporation (NYSE:ALB).KPS Capital Partners, LP entered into a Stock Purchase Agreement to acquire Ketjen Corporation from Albemarle Corporation (NYSE:ALB) for $800 million on October 25, 2025. Under the terms of the Stock Purchase Agreement, Albemarle Corporation will sell 51% of the common stock of Ketjen (Purchased Shares) to KPS Capital Partners and contribute remaining 49% of common stock of Ketjen to Holdco, that was organized by and is affiliated with KPS Capital Partners LP. At the closing of the sale, contribution and other transactions contemplated by the Stock Purchase Agreement (collectively, the “Transaction”), Albemarle will receive an estimated $536 million in cash and will own common units of Holdco (the “Rollover Equity”). Under the Stock Purchase Agreement, the purchase price for the Purchased Shares is $800.0 million, less the value ascribed to the Contributed Shares pursuant to the terms and conditions of the Stock Purchase Agreement, and is further subject to adjustment for closing cash, indebtedness, net working capital and transaction expenses. Albemarle and KPS, through affiliates, will own approximately 49% and 51% of Ketjen at close, respectively, with KPS having a majority of the Board of Directors and operational control of Ketjen. The debt financing has been provided by Barclays, Jefferies, BNP Paribas and Santander. The termination fee of $32.5 million has to be paid by KPS Capital Partners, LP to Albemarle Corporation, if the closing has not occurred by April 30, 2026. The transactions is expected to be completed in the first half of 2026, with both subject to customary closing conditions and regulatory approvals, including the expiration or early termination of the waiting period under the Hart-Scott-Rodino Antitrust Improvements Act of 1976, as amended (the “HSR Act”), as well as approvals from competition and foreign investment authorities from certain non-U.S. jurisdictions and certain other governmental authorities. Goldman Sachs & Co. LLC acted as financial advisor and K&L Gates LLP acted as legal advisor for Albemarle Corporation. Paul, Weiss, Rifkind, Wharton & Garrison LLP acted as legal advisor and Raymond James Financial, Inc. acted as financial advisor for KPS Capital Partners, LP. Roel Fluit, Michel van Agt, Guido Koop, and Vincent van der Lans of Loyens & Loeff acted as legal advisor to KPS Capital Partners. KPS Capital Partners, LP completed the acquisition of 51% stake in Ketjen Corporation from Albemarle Corporation (NYSE:ALB) on March 2, 2026. Albemarle will retain reamining 49% stake in Ketjen.

お知らせ • Aug 12Albemarle Announces Executive Changes, Effective August 11, 2025Albemarle Corporation announced changes to its organizational structure to further align the company for agility and efficiency. These enhancements are designed to accelerate the company's market-led enterprise strategy and focus on operational excellence. Effective as of August 11, 2025: Mark Mummert will lead an integrated function of resources, manufacturing, capital and supply chain as chief operations officer continuing to report to Kent Masters, Albemarle's chairman and CEO. In this role, he will ensure optimization of Albemarle's world-class resources, including joint venture management, as well as global manufacturing. In addition, he will oversee capital projects and supply chain in a fully integrated operating model. With this change, Netha Johnson is leaving the company. Autumn Gagarinas will become Albemarle's chief people and workplace transformation officer, also reporting to Masters, to focus on talent and culture, as well as business process and technology optimization. Autumn has been serving as Albemarle's vice president of human resources for over two years and has over two decades of human resources experience. Melissa Anderson will continue to report to Masters and will lead Albemarle's enterprise strategy and growth, as well as research and technology as chief business transformation officer.

お知らせ • Jul 31Albemarle Corporation Announces Executive Changeslbemarle Corporation announced that Ander Krupa has been promoted to executive vice president, general counsel, corporate secretary, and chief compliance officer. Krupa joined Albemarle in May 2017 as vice president, deputy general counsel, and assistant corporate secretary. He has served in leadership roles supporting Albemarle's global business units, commercial activities, and mergers and acquisitions. Krupa has more than 15 years of practice in the manufacturing industry and deep experience across Albemarle's businesses. Prior to Albemarle, Krupa served as assistant general counsel, governance, and securities for BWX Technologies Inc. and The Babcock & Wilcox Company. He was also an attorney with the international law firm of Greenberg Traurig LLP in the firm's corporate and securities practice group. Krupa received a bachelor's degree from the University of Georgia and earned his J.D. from Georgia State University College of Law. He is based in the company's Charlotte, N.C., headquarters and will report to Kent Masters as part of Albemarle's executive leadership team. Krupa assumes the role following the passing in April of Albemarle's former general counsel, corporate secretary, and chief compliance officer, Stacy Grant, at which time he was named as interim general counsel.
